if you've been around GPUs for as long as we have, you know how this started.
in 2007 Nvidia shipped CUDA and turned a graphics card into a general-purpose computer. every model you use today runs on that idea.
then DePIN took the next step. Render, Akash, https://t.co/nnksSO2qU6 and the marketplaces that followed proved that spare GPUs could be pooled and rented onchain.
what nobody did is let a token pay the bill.
every GPU marketplace still ends at the same place: someone opens a wallet and pays per hour.
we want to carry that idea forward on Robinhood Chain. a token is launched, it trades, and the fees from that trading buy the GPU-hours themselves.
CUDA made the card programmable. DePIN made it rentable.
we want to make it fundable.

1/5
Here's how it works:
every token launches on a bonding curve and is backed by one GPU SKU, from an H100 in a datacenter to a DGX Spark on someone's desk.
every trade carries a 2% creator fee. instead of going to the creator, it is claimed into a treasury and split: 50% GPU-hours, 30% buyback & burn allocation, 20% protocol.
